Instead of the onion routing Tor uses, I2P relies on unidirectional tunnels and garlic routing, which bundles multiple messages together for better traffic obfuscation. It uses its own internal DNS to access “eepsites”, not .onion addresses. This setup is easy to configure, and you don’t need any special settings or features. All v3 .onion addresses (the current standard) are 56 characters long and end with “d” to denote the URL version in use. Each address also contains cryptographic information that enables a dark web browser to connect to the site. That allows .onion sites to be accessible anonymously without services like DNS. One study found that only 6.7% of Tor anonymity network daily users — a cohort that comprises mostly dark web users — connect to onion sites used for illicit activity. This essentially means that over 93% of Tor daily users use the dark web for legitimate reasons. Accessing the dark web is not inherently illegal in most countries, as it is simply a hidden part of the internet that can be accessed through the use of certain software or configurations.

If your incoming traffic passes through a node run by cybercriminals, they could inject malware into the response code. If your device is unprotected, you could be a victim of malware or a hacking attack. You can never be sure of the motive of the person operating the node that your traffic is routed through.
